There is a significant difference between a wedding and a marriage. Weddings are an event. It’s a day you prepare for. On that day, you make a commitment to accompany another person throughout the rest of your days.
Marriage, of course, is where that commitment gets hashed out in the nitty-gritty reality of everyday life. But that wedding day commitment—the words spoken and the sentiment exchanged—is not something that is left in the past. No, it is something that is continually renewed each and every day.
So, too, is God’s agreement in today’s readings. Sometimes we forget that our mutual commitment to God is continually renewed through the living out of our faith each day. It isn’t something we leave in some past conversion moment, in the font of Baptism or the oil of Confirmation. Faith, like marriage, is the living out of a promise.
